Judgment text excerpt
The Supreme Court held that under Section 13(1)(a) and Section 16 of the West Bengal Premises Tenancy Act, 1956, a landlord's previous written consent is mandatory for the creation of sub-tenancy, and failure to obtain such consent constitutes a valid ground for eviction. The Court clarified that mere acceptance of rent by the landlord after knowledge of sub-letting does not amount to a waiver of the right to evict the tenant. The appeal by the tenant was dismissed, affirming the lower court's decision to grant eviction based on sub-letting without consent.
